How much is a return flight from Mumbai to London?

This analysis is based on the cheapest return trip price found on KAYAK in the last 12 months by searching for a flight from Mumbai to London departing in April.

What is the cheapest Mumbai to London flight route?

Data is based on round-trip flight searches on KAYAK over the past month.

The cheapest return flight from Mumbai to London costs £218 on the route between Mumbai (BOM) and London Heathrow Airport (LHR). It is also the most popular route.

What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Mumbai to London?

The average price of all round-trip flights from Mumbai to London cl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

When flying from Mumbai to London, you should consider leaving on a Thursday and avoid Sundays if you are looking for the best rates. For your return to Mumbai, you’ll find the best rates on Wednesdays and the most expensive ones on Fridays.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Mumbai to London?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Mumbai to London,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Mumbai to London is October, where tickets cost £487 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are January and April,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is £587 and £567 respectively.

Can I save money by flying with a stopover from Mumbai to London?

The average return price for all direct flights, flights with one stopover, and flights with two stopovers for the route found by users searching on KAYAK in the last 2 weeks.

Yes, flying with a stopover may cost you more time, but you can also save money on the route, with a 1 stop stopover the cheapest option at £415 on average.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Mumbai to London?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Mumbai to London,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from Mumbai to London, you should book around 7 weeks before departure, which saves you about 11%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 22 weeks before departure.

FAQs for booking flights from Mumbai to London

  • Are there any onsite airport hotels at Mumbai Chhatrapati Shivaji airport?

    If you would like to stay close to the airport before an early morning flight from Mumbai to London, there are 5 hotels all within 5 minutes of the airport and all offering free airport shuttle transfers. Alternatively, if you are flying from Terminal 2, Niranta Airport Transit Hotel & Lounge is located in the airport inside the terminal and you can book a room for 4, 7 or 24 hours.

  • Are there any showers available at London Heathrow airport?

    Passengers who would like to freshen up after a long flight from Mumbai to London Heathrow airport can do so at one of the showers available at the airport. They are can be used for a fee at the Plaza Premium Lounges in Terminals 2 and 3, at the Travellers Lounge in Terminal 3, and at the Aspire Lounge & Spa at Terminal 5.

  • How do I catch public transport from London Heathrow airport to get to the city centre?

    A lot of different bus lines and coaches operate from the airport throughout the day, and if you are catching a bus, you should head to the central bus station located close to Terminals 2 and 3. If you are catching the tube, you will find 3 underground stations at the airport, one close to Terminal 2 and 3, one at Terminal 4 and the third at Terminal 5. Trains depart about every 10 minutes and can get you to the city centre in under an hour.

  • Are there any smoking rooms in the Mumbai or London airports?

    Smoking rooms can be easily found at the Mumbai Chhatrapati Shivaji airport – in fact there are over 15 locations spread through terminals 1B, 1C, and 2. Smoking is not permitted inside any of the London airports. Instead there are designated smoking areas outside the terminals that you can access once you’ve exited the airport building.

  • Where can I stay in hotels at London’s airports?

    For those that arrive late at night or early in the morning in London, you may want to stay at an airport hotel before you continue your journey. For instance, there is Aerotel close to the terminal at Heathrow Airport (LHR), Courtyard by Marriott at Gatwick Airport (LGW) or Holiday Inn Express at London City Airport (LCY).

KAYAK’s top tips for finding a cheap flight from Mumbai to London

  • Looking for a cheap flight from Mumbai to London? 25% of our users found flights on this route for £242 or less one-way and £468 or less round-trip.
  • If you need to exchange some money before your flight from Mumbai to London, you can do so at Mumbai Chhatrapati Shivaji airport at Terminal 1 Arrivals, or at 8 different locations in Terminal 2. You can also do so at any of the London airports, as they all have currency exchange offices or ATMs if you'd prefer to withdraw some cash on arrival.
  • Passengers who are traveling with kids will find child care rooms at Mumbai Chhatrapati Shivaji airport in Terminals 1 and 2, which come equipped with changing tables and provide some privacy for feeding infants. If you need some baby milk on arrival at London Heathrow airport, you can get some from Boots Drugstore, which you can find in all terminals, however you need to pre-order 2 days before your flight.
  • If you wish to take a direct flight from Mumbai to London, you can fly with Air India, British Airways, Virgin Atlantic or Jet Airways, and you will land in London Heathrow airport. All those airlines have a 23kg luggage allowance, but if you’re looking for the most comfortable seats, Air India’s seats have 84cm leg room on average.
  • Those who need to recharge their mobile phones on arrival can do so at the Free Power Pole charging stations available all through Heathrow airport, where you can connect up to 8 devices using UK or European plugs or a USB connection. London Gatwick airport has ChargeBox kiosks in the departure halls of both terminals, where you can lock your phone and leave it to charge for a fee. London Luton airport also has UK power sockets and USB connections throughout the airport that passengers can use for free.
  • There are 24-hour food options at all airports, and though they are limited, if your flight leaves or arrives late at night, you will not be left hungry. In addition, London Heathrow airport has water fountains throughout all terminals of the airport, so you can refill your water bottle for free at any time of the day.
  • If you are departing from Mumbai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j International Airport (BOM) and have a disability, you can request assistance from your airline provider for transiting through the terminal. It’s recommended to contact them at least 48 hours in advance.
  • Upon landing at one of London’s airports, you can reach a range of nearby cities. For example, from Stansted Airport (STN), you can get to Norwich in about 1h 30min or Cambridge in around 40min by car. From Heathrow Airport (LHR), you can go to Swindon in approximately 1 hour or to Reading in around 40min.
